What conversion rate does a dental website design typically produce?
Well-designed dental websites convert 4 to 8 percent of qualified traffic into booked appointments. Redefine Web's client baseline after redesign averages 5.4 percent visitor-to-booked-patient conversion, measured monthly against the PMS.
Four inputs move the conversion rate up or down.
- Mobile speed. A LCP under 2.5 seconds on mobile is the floor. Slower sites bounce before the booking widget loads.
- Insurance visibility. Insurance carriers accepted, listed above the fold on the homepage and every treatment page. Dental patients filter on insurance first.
- Click-to-call placement. Sticky phone bar on mobile, phone above the fold on desktop. Dental is still a phone-heavy vertical.
- Treatment-page depth. One page per money treatment (implants, aligners, veneers, full-arch) with pricing framework and financing options.

Do you offer HIPAA-compliant dental website design?
Yes. Every dental website design from Redefine Web ships with HIPAA-aware infrastructure so patient intake and booking data stay compliant from day one.
- HIPAA-aware form processor. Gravity Forms with BAA-covered add-ons, or Formstack HIPAA, or a custom TLS-encrypted submit-to-PMS flow.
- Encrypted transport and storage. TLS 1.3 on the site, encrypted-at-rest on the form processor.
- Access controls. Role-based CMS accounts, audit trail on patient data views.
- BAA support. We facilitate BAAs with your form processor, hosting provider, and any third-party integration that touches patient data.
The HIPAA workflow audit is included on Growth tier ($3,500) and above. It's a written document showing every point where patient data enters, moves, or leaves the system, plus the BAAs in place for each.
HIPAA compliance is the practice's legal responsibility. Our role is to build the site so the compliance work is straightforward, not a landmine.
Can you redesign an existing dental website without losing rankings?
Yes. Dental website redesigns are the majority of Redefine Web's dental web design work. Every redesign runs through a 5-step SEO preservation process so organic traffic stays flat or grows on launch, not drops.
- Rank inventory. Full Search Console + Ahrefs pull of every URL currently getting organic traffic, ranked pages, backlinks, and top queries.
- Redirect map. 1-to-1 redirect map from old URLs to new URLs. No 302s, no chains.
- Content parity. Every ranking page's content preserved or expanded on the new URL. Never truncated.
- Schema migration. DentalPractice, MedicalProcedure, and Review schema ported and re-validated.
- Post-launch monitoring. Search Console + rank tracker for 90 days post-launch. Any URL that drops gets triaged inside 48 hours.

What CMS do you build dental websites on?
Redefine Web builds dental websites on two stacks: WordPress with a lean custom theme, or custom PHP for teams that want zero page-builder overhead. Both hit Core Web Vitals green at launch.
WordPress is the default choice for most practices. Office managers edit content without a developer, the plugin ecosystem covers booking + reviews + forms, and hiring your next developer or agency is easier because WordPress is a common skill.
Custom PHP is the pick when speed is non-negotiable (large DSOs, high-traffic sites) or when the practice has an in-house engineer who prefers control. It's lighter, faster, and diff-able. The downside is content edits need a developer.
Neither stack uses Elementor, Divi, Wix, Squarespace, or GoDaddy Builder. Those platforms slow the site down, lock the practice into a vendor, and make dental SEO harder to execute.

The reason ongoing support matters. Dental websites left un-maintained typically lose 20 to 40% of ranking pages inside 12 months to WordPress core updates, plugin breakage, and Core Web Vitals drift. The retainer is cheaper than the rebuild.
